维生素D水平对膝关节影像学骨关节炎及功能状态的影响。

Effect of vitamin D levels on radiographic knee osteoarthritis and functional status.

Abstract

OBJECTIVES

This study aims to investigate the effect of serum levels of 25 hydroxyvitamin D (25(OH)D) in patients with primary knee osteoarthritis (OA) and to assess its relationship with the radiographic grading and functional status.

PATIENTS AND METHODS

Serum 25(OH)D levels were measured in 107 patients (90 females, 17 males; mean age 63.0±9.6 years; range, 40 to 86 years) with primary knee OA. Radiographic grading was based on the Kellgren-Lawrence Grading Scale and the Osteoarthritis Research Society International (OARSI) Atlas Grading Scale, while the functional status was assessed using the Lequesne indices and Turkish version of the Knee Injury and Osteoarthritis Outcome Score-Physical Function Short-Form (KOOS-PS). Pain was evaluated using the Visual Analog Scale for Pain (VAS-Pain). Data including age, sex, disease duration, body mass index (BMI), and pain severity were recorded.

RESULTS

The mean 25(OH)D level was 13.4±10.6 ng/mL, and 90 patients (84.1%) had vitamin D deficiency. The presence of severe osteophytes was observed in 67 patients (62.6%) and 85 patients (79.4%) had Grade 2-3 joint space narrowing (JSN). The mean KOOS-PS and Lequesne scores were 40.1±12.3 and 12.9±3.6, respectively. There was no correlation between serum 25(OH)D levels and functional status.

CONCLUSION

Our study results show that serum 25(OH)D level is not related to the severity of the radiographic knee OA grading or to the functional assessment. Age and BMI are the factors affecting the radiological knee OA severity, while age, sex, BMI, and pain severity are the main determinants of the functional status.

摘要

目的

本研究旨在调查原发性膝关节骨关节炎(OA)患者血清25羟维生素D(25(OH)D)水平的影响,并评估其与放射学分级和功能状态的关系。

患者与方法

对107例原发性膝关节OA患者(90例女性,17例男性;平均年龄63.0±9.6岁;范围40至86岁)测定血清25(OH)D水平。放射学分级基于Kellgren-Lawrence分级量表和国际骨关节炎研究学会(OARSI)图谱分级量表,而功能状态则使用Lequesne指数和膝关节损伤与骨关节炎结果评分-身体功能简表(KOOS-PS)的土耳其语版本进行评估。使用视觉模拟疼痛量表(VAS-疼痛)评估疼痛。记录包括年龄、性别、病程、体重指数(BMI)和疼痛严重程度在内的数据。

结果

25(OH)D平均水平为13.4±10.6 ng/mL,90例患者(84.1%)存在维生素D缺乏。67例患者(62.6%)观察到严重骨赘,85例患者(79.4%)存在2-3级关节间隙狭窄(JSN)。KOOS-PS和Lequesne评分的平均值分别为40.1±12.3和12.9±3.6。血清25(OH)D水平与功能状态之间无相关性。

结论

我们的研究结果表明,血清25(OH)D水平与膝关节OA放射学分级的严重程度或功能评估无关。年龄和BMI是影响膝关节OA放射学严重程度的因素,而年龄、性别、BMI和疼痛严重程度是功能状态的主要决定因素。
